Commit aa6e83fd by Ben Patterson

Allow consumption of environment variables in docs Makefiles

See: https://bitbucket.org/birkenfeld/sphinx/issue/1368/makefile-options-not-overridable-from
parent 136bcb29
...@@ -2,10 +2,10 @@ ...@@ -2,10 +2,10 @@
# #
# You can set these variables from the command line. # You can set these variables from the command line.
SPHINXOPTS = SPHINXOPTS ?=
SPHINXBUILD = sphinx-build SPHINXBUILD ?= sphinx-build
PAPER = PAPER ?=
BUILDDIR = build BUILDDIR ?= build
# User-friendly check for sphinx-build # User-friendly check for sphinx-build
ifeq ($(shell which $(SPHINXBUILD) >/dev/null 2>&1; echo $$?), 1) ifeq ($(shell which $(SPHINXBUILD) >/dev/null 2>&1; echo $$?), 1)
